Supply Chain Analysis of the Lithium-Ion Battery Anode Market

Feedstock Procurement

  • The raw materials for the production of the anode of lithium batteries come from natural graphite, synthetic graphite, silicon precursors, and other raw materials. 
  • Guaranteeing the supply of raw materials guarantees stability of quality and uninterrupted manufacturing operations.
  • BTR New Energy Materials: BTR New Energy Materials acquires high-quality natural and synthetic graphite from all over the world. It has a broad sourcing base, ensuring reliable supplies of raw materials for battery companies.
  • Other Key Players: Shanshan, POSCO Future M, Rio Tinto.

Chemical Synthesis and Processing

  • The raw materials are purified, shaped, and graphitized to obtain battery-grade anode materials. 
  • This step enhances the purity, conductivity, and structural stability of materials, which is crucial for the development of high-performance batteries.
  • POSCO Future M: The advanced graphitization technologies used in the production of high-purity synthetic graphite by POSCO Future M convert the precursor materials. 
  • Other Key Players: BTR, Hitachi Chemical (Resonac), Mitsubishi Chemical.

Compound Formulation and Blending

  • The conducting additives, binders, and solvents are mixed with the active anode material to form a uniform slurry. 
  • Good formulation results in better adherence, uniformity of coatings, and battery performance.
  • LG Energy Solution: LG Energy Solution prepares superior high-density anode slurry formulations that are optimized in material ratios. Its technologies enhance the quality and efficiency of electrode manufacturing in battery manufacturing.
  • Other Key Players: SK On, Panasonic, Contemporary Amperex Technology Co. Limited (CATL).

What is the Lithium-Ion Battery Anode?

The negative electrode of a lithium-ion battery, the lithium-ion battery anode, stores and releases lithium ions during battery charging and discharging cycles, allowing for efficient and stable battery operation, enhanced conductivity, and robust electrochemical performance in a variety of applications.

Pricing Analysis for the Lithium-Ion Battery Anode Market

The pricing of the anode market for lithium batteries is influenced by the availability of raw materials, the complexity of the processing, the scale of the manufacturing, and the fluctuations in the supply and demand situation in battery production all over the world. Natural and synthetic graphite remain the key cost drivers, whereas silicon-based materials have an increased processing cost due to the specific manufacturing needs. The overall production costs are greatly affected by the method of purification, the graphitisation, and the chemical processing of the raw materials used for batteries.

Regulatory Framework: Lithium-Ion Battery Anode Market

Country Region    Regulatory Body    Key Regulations    Focus Areas   
Asia Pacific   MIIT Chin China GB/T Standard Looks after domestic standards and comprehensive lifecycle rules for battery components.
North America   U.S. Department of Energy (DOE U.S. DOT Hazardous Materials Regulation Sourcing transparency, reducing foreign entity of concern (FEOC) dependency for the critical anode mineral
European Union   European Chemicals Agency (ECHA EU Battery Regulation (EU 2023/1542 Mandatory carbon footprint declarations, strict ESG supply chain rules

Recent Developments

  • In June 2026, Oman announced a USD 1 billion plant to produce lithium-ion battery anode materials in Sohar Free Zone. Zhongke Electric started the construction work via its subsidiary, which will help to build overseas production capacity, promote economic diversification, and enhance the companys global capacity to produce lithium-ion battery anodes.m(Source: www.energetica-india.net )
  • In May 2026, Epsilon Advanced Materials Pvt. Ltd. unveiled its Hard Carbon Anode material for grid-scale energy storage applications of Sodium-ion Batteries. The material, which was developed through in-house research, is graphite-free, improves commercial sodium-ion battery applications, and aids in the sustainable production of batteries.(Source: www.alchempro.com)
